深度解析Shadowrocket4G:从入门到精通的网络代理配置指南
引言:为什么选择Shadowrocket4G?
在当今互联网时代,网络自由与隐私安全成为越来越多用户的刚需。无论是突破地域限制访问全球资源,还是保护个人数据免受窥探,一款高效可靠的代理工具都显得尤为重要。而Shadowrocket4G凭借其多协议支持、智能流量管理和简洁的操作界面,已然成为iOS及安卓用户的首选工具之一。本文将带您全面了解这款工具的安装、配置及优化技巧,助您轻松驾驭网络代理的奥秘。
第一章 Shadowrocket4G的核心功能解析
1.1 多协议代理支持
Shadowrocket4G兼容Shadowsocks、HTTP、SOCKS5等多种代理协议,用户可根据服务器类型灵活选择。例如:
- Shadowsocks:适合需要高加密强度的场景
- SOCKS5:支持UDP流量,适合游戏或视频通话
- HTTP代理:快速配置企业内网或基础翻墙需求
1.2 隐私保护机制
通过隧道加密技术,Shadowrocket4G可有效防止DNS泄漏和流量劫持。实测显示,启用后能减少90%以上的中间人攻击风险。
1.3 智能流量管理
特色功能包括:
- 分应用代理:仅让指定App(如Twitter或Netflix)走代理
- 流量统计:实时监控各应用的带宽消耗
- 省电模式:后台自动休眠非活跃连接
第二章 手把手安装教程
2.1 iOS设备安装流程
- 打开App Store,切换至非中国大陆区账号(如美区ID)
- 搜索“Shadowrocket”,注意识别正版开发者信息
- 点击下载后,需在设置-通用-设备管理中信任开发者证书
2.2 安卓设备注意事项
由于Google Play下架此类应用,建议:
- 从GitHub等可信平台获取APK
- 安装前开启“允许未知来源应用”选项
- 推荐搭配Clash for Android作备用方案
第三章 配置实战:从零到连接成功
3.1 服务器配置详解
以Shadowsocks为例:
类型:Shadowsocks 地址:your_server_ip 端口:443 密码:your_password 加密方式:chacha20-ietf-poly1305
注:建议启用「混淆插件」应对深度包检测
3.2 代理模式选择策略
| 模式 | 适用场景 | 优缺点 |
|------|----------|--------|
| 全局代理 | 需要完全匿名 | 耗流量但覆盖全面 |
| 规则分流 | 日常使用 | 节省资源,需维护规则列表 |
| 直连优先 | 仅偶尔翻墙 | 速度最快但隐私性弱 |
3.3 配置文件一键导入
高级用户可通过扫描二维码或导入.ss文件快速部署:
1. 获取订阅链接后粘贴至「订阅」栏目
2. 开启「自动更新」保持节点最新
3. 使用「延迟测试」功能筛选最优服务器
第四章 进阶技巧与故障排查
4.1 速度优化方案
- MTU值调整:改为1400-1450避免分片
- DNS设置:推荐使用Cloudflare(1.1.1.1)或Quad9
- 节点优选:通过延迟测试+丢包率综合评估
4.2 常见问题解决
- 连接失败:检查防火墙设置或尝试更换端口(如443/80)
- 速度骤降:关闭IPv6或切换加密方式(如aes-256-gcm)
- 应用闪退:清除缓存或重装最新版本
第五章 安全使用指南
5.1 风险防范措施
- 避免使用免费公共节点(可能记录流量)
- 定期更换密码与加密密钥
- 开启「局域网隔离」防止设备间嗅探
5.2 法律合规提醒
不同地区对代理工具的使用存在法律差异,建议:
- 仅用于合法学术研究或企业授权访问
- 不参与任何形式的网络攻击行为
结语:网络自由的双刃剑
Shadowrocket4G如同一把精巧的瑞士军刀,既能为用户打开信息世界的枷锁,也需谨慎挥舞以防伤己。通过本文的详细教程,相信您已掌握其核心用法。但请始终铭记:技术本无善恶,关键在于使用者的选择与责任。愿每位读者都能在数字海洋中安全航行,抵达理想的彼岸。
精彩点评:
这篇指南以技术干货为骨、人文思考为魂,既满足了新手“照做就能用”的实操需求,又为进阶用户提供了深度调优的空间。文中将枯燥的参数配置转化为场景化的决策建议(如代理模式对比表格),堪称“技术文档用户体验化”的典范。最后的伦理探讨更是点睛之笔,体现了科技作者应有的社会责任感。
穿梭数字边界的艺术:Shadowrocket国内规则深度解析与高效配置指南
在当今全球互联的时代,网络已成为我们呼吸的空气、瞭望世界的窗口。然而,无形的数字边界却将一片广阔的信息海洋隔离开来。在中国,这道边界尤为明显,许多国际网站、学术资源与社交平台无法直接触及。正是在这样的背景下,一款名为Shadowrocket的工具,悄然成为了无数iOS用户手中的“数字钥匙”,帮助他们在合规的前提下,探索更广阔的网络世界。它不仅仅是一个代理工具,更是一套精巧的系统,其核心魅力在于对“规则”的深刻理解与灵活运用。本文将深入解析Shadowrocket在国内环境下的核心规则逻辑,并分享从入门到精通的配置技巧,旨在为你打造一条既安全又高效的数字通道。
第一章:Shadowrocket——不仅仅是工具,更是策略
Shadowrocket是一款专为iOS平台设计的网络代理工具。其设计哲学并非简单的流量转发,而是智能的路由决策。它支持Shadowsocks、VMess、Trojan、HTTP等多种协议,像一个精通多国语言的向导,能够根据你的指令,选择最合适的路径将数据送达目的地。
它的必要性体现在三个层面: 1. 突破访问限制:这是最直接的需求。通过连接境外代理服务器,用户可以访问被区域限制的网站与应用,获取信息、进行学术研究或国际交流。 2. 强化隐私护城河:在网络监控日益普遍的今天,隐藏真实IP地址、加密传输数据,是保护个人隐私不被窥探、避免数据泄露的基本防御手段。 3. 优化网络体验:有时,一条优质的代理线路反而能提供比直连更稳定、更快速的国际网络连接,尤其对于视频流媒体、大型文件下载等场景。
然而,简单地“全局代理”并非上策。它会导致访问国内网站速度变慢、消耗不必要的代理流量,甚至可能因IP地址异常触发某些国内服务的风控机制。因此,“规则” 便是Shadowrocket的灵魂所在,它实现了智能分流:该走代理的走代理,该直连的直连。
第二章:国内规则的核心逻辑——精准分流之道
Shadowrocket的国内规则,其本质是一套精细化的流量路由指令集。它的核心目标是:在确保能访问境外资源的同时,最大限度保障国内网络体验的流畅与稳定。
一套典型的、高效的国内规则通常遵循以下原则:
1. 国内直连,境外代理 这是最基本的分流逻辑。所有归属于中国大陆的IP地址和域名(如.cn, .com.cn后缀,以及百度、淘宝、腾讯等国内主流服务的域名)都应设置为直连(DIRECT)。反之,对于国际网站(如Google, YouTube, Twitter, Wikipedia等)的流量,则通过代理服务器(PROXY)转发。
2. 细分规则类别 * GEOIP规则:基于IP地址的地理位置进行分流。这是最准确的方式之一。规则集会包含完整的中国IP地址段(由APNIC分配),确保任何国内服务器的连接都不会绕道境外。 * 域名规则: * 后缀匹配:如 *.cn, *.com.cn。 * 关键字匹配:如 *taobao*, *baidu*。 * 全域名匹配:如 www.gov.cn。 * 协议规则:可以指定特定协议或端口的流量处理方式。
3. 规则优先级 Shadowrocket按照规则列表从上到下的顺序匹配流量。因此,通常将最具体、最明确的规则放在前面(如某个特定国内App的域名),将通用规则放在后面(如GEOIP CN)。一条“FINAL, PROXY”的最终规则会兜底处理所有未被前面规则匹配的流量,通常将其设置为走代理,以确保未知的境外流量能被正确处理。
第三章:从零开始——手把手配置实战
理解了规则逻辑,我们来实践配置。假设你已获得一个可用的代理服务器信息(地址、端口、协议、密码等)。
步骤一:服务器配置 1. 打开Shadowrocket,点击右上角“+”。 2. 根据你的服务器类型选择(如Shadowsocks、VMess等)。 3. 准确填写服务器地址、端口、加密方式、密码(或UUID)等信息。一个字符的错误都会导致连接失败。 4. 为这个配置命名,如“日本-东京节点”。
步骤二:导入与配置规则(关键步骤) 手动编写规则复杂且易错,推荐导入成熟的规则集。 1. 在Shadowrocket中,点击底部“配置”选项卡。 2. 点击右上角“+”,选择“从URL下载配置”。 3. 输入一个可靠的规则集订阅链接(可在相关技术社区或博客找到,通常以.conf结尾)。一份好的规则集会内置数千条经过优化的国内外域名和IP规则。 4. 下载完成后,在“配置”列表中选择它作为当前配置。 5. 进入“设置”->“代理”,确保你刚才添加的服务器已被选中。
步骤三:测试与微调 1. 开启Shadowrocket顶部开关,连接代理。 2. 访问 ip.cn 或 ipinfo.io 查看当前IP地址,确认已变为代理服务器所在地。 3. 分别访问 baidu.com 和 google.com。理想情况下,百度应快速加载且显示国内IP(直连成功),谷歌应能访问且显示国外IP(代理成功)。 4. 微调:如果发现某个国内网站走了代理导致变慢,或某个境外网站没走代理无法访问,你可以在“配置”->“编辑本地文件”中,在规则列表的合适位置添加自定义规则。例如,为某个总是慢的国内视频站添加一条 DOMAIN-SUFFIX,example.com, DIRECT 确保其直连。
第四章:进阶配置技巧——打造专属网络体验
掌握了基础,你可以通过以下技巧让Shadowrocket更贴合个人需求:
1. 情景模式切换 * 全局模式:所有流量无差别通过代理。适用于需要高度匿名或测试代理稳定性的场景,但不适合日常使用。 * 规则模式:日常使用模式,根据规则智能分流。 * 直连模式:完全关闭代理,所有流量直连。
2. DNS配置优化 DNS解析速度直接影响网站打开速度。建议在Shadowrocket设置中,使用可靠的国内外DNS服务器,如 223.5.5.5(阿里云)、8.8.8.8(Google)。可以设置“代理DNS”,让通过代理的域名的DNS查询也走代理,避免DNS污染。
3. 利用“策略组”实现负载均衡与高可用 对于拥有多个代理服务器的用户,可以创建“策略组”。例如: * 自动选择:组内延迟最低的服务器将被自动选用。 * 故障转移:按顺序尝试服务器,直到找到一个可用的。 * URL测试:定期测试服务器对特定网址的访问情况。 这能有效提升连接稳定性和体验。
4. 协议选择浅析 * Shadowsocks:轻量、高效、兼容性好,是经久不衰的经典选择,平衡了速度与隐蔽性。 * VMess:V2Ray核心协议,功能强大,支持动态端口、传输层伪装(如WebSocket),在对抗深度包检测方面更有优势,速度通常表现优异。 * Trojan:模仿HTTPS流量,伪装性极强,在严格网络环境下穿透能力出色,但配置相对复杂。 选择哪种协议,很大程度上取决于你的代理服务提供商的支持情况以及当前网络环境。在普通环境下,三者体验差异不大;在限制严格的网络(如某些校园网、企业网),Trojan或VMess+WebSocket+TLS的组合可能更稳定。
第五章:常见问题与安全提醒
Q:连接成功但无法访问任何网站? A:检查规则配置是否正确,特别是最终(FINAL)规则。尝试切换不同的DNS服务器。
Q:如何获取可靠的规则订阅链接和代理服务器? A:规则集可在GitHub等开源平台搜索“Shadowrocket Rules”找到。代理服务器则需要自行寻找可靠的服务提供商,切勿使用来源不明的免费代理,它们可能存在严重的安全与隐私风险。
Q:Shadowrocket是免费的吗? A:Shadowrocket本身在App Store是一次性付费购买的应用。代理服务则需要另行付费订阅。请警惕任何声称提供“免费破解版”的渠道,它们极可能植入恶意代码。
安全第一准则: 1. 信任你的服务提供商:这是安全链条中最重要的一环。 2. 及时更新:定期更新Shadowrocket应用和规则配置,以应对网络环境的变化。 3. 敏感操作勿代理:进行网上银行、重要账户登录等操作时,建议关闭代理直接连接,确保绝对安全。 4. 理解法律边界:使用工具的目的是为了学习和访问公开信息,务必遵守当地法律法规,不进行任何非法活动。
语言精彩点评
通观全文,其语言风格呈现出一种 “技术理性与人文关怀交织” 的特质。开篇将网络比作“空气”和“窗口”,将限制喻为“边界”,而Shadowrocket则是“数字钥匙”,这种诗意的起笔瞬间拉近了与读者的距离,将冷冰冰的技术工具赋予了使命感和解放色彩。在阐述核心规则时,使用了 “灵魂”、“向导”、“护城河” 等隐喻,化抽象为具象,使复杂的路由概念变得易于理解。
文章结构严谨,逻辑递进清晰,从“是什么”、“为什么”到“怎么做”,宛如一位耐心的导师引领读者步步深入。在操作指南部分,语言切换为简洁、准确的指令式风格,避免歧义;而在进阶与安全部分,语气则转为谨慎、提醒,体现了对读者负责任的态度。特别是“安全第一准则”的强调,展现了在传授“突破”技巧时,牢牢守住了合规与安全的底线,这是一种难能可贵的平衡。
结尾虽在原始材料中略显突兀,但经整合后,全文收束于对工具价值的肯定和对安全、合规使用的呼吁,形成了完整的闭环。整体而言,这篇文章成功地将一个可能涉及敏感话题的技术指南,转化为一篇积极、建设性、专注于提升个人网络体验与数字素养的优质分享,语言在平实与生动间找到了优雅的平衡点。
通过深度解析与精心配置,Shadowrocket便能超越其工具属性,成为你探索无垠数字世界的一位可靠、智能的伙伴。在这片由数据构成的海洋中,愿你能借助智慧与规则,安全、自由地航行,抵达更广阔的知识彼岸。